The September twelfth debate is set. There are ten participants only. They are, in order of importance:

Former vice president Joe Biden, Sen. Bernie Sanders of Vermont, Sen. Kamala Harris of California, Sen. Elizabeth Warren of Massachusetts, South Bend mayor Pete Buttigieg, Sen. Cory Booker of New Jersey, Sen. Amy Klobuchar of Minnesota, entrepreneur Andrew Yang, former HUD secretary Julián Castro and former Texas congressman Beto O’Rourke.

Tulsi, Williamson, and Steyer are the outliers who have missed the stage but not by much. Here is more:
